Wheezing (Dyspnea) Is Associated With 4 TCM Herbs

Tonify Kidney, strengthen yang - impotence, premature ejaculation, cold and painful lower back. Stabilizes jing and reserves urine - enuresis, incontinence of urine, frequent urination, spermatorrhea. Tonify and strengthen spleen yang - cold deficient spleen diarrhea, borborygmus, abdominal pain.…

Promotes the movement of Qi, alleviates pain - distention and pain in abdominal region due to cold from deficiency or blood stasis. Directs rebellious Qi downward - excess/deficiency wheezing, vomiting, belching, hiccups due to cold from deficiency of the middle jiao. Helps the kidneys grasp Qi -…

Redirects qi downward and stops coughing - cough and wheezing from many different etiologies, most often used for different types of cold. Frying in honey enhances moistening function of the lungs - good for dry cough.

Re-directs rebellious lung qi downward, expels phlegm - coughing, wheezing with thick sputum due to heat in the lungs. Releases wind-heat from the exterior w/cough and copious phlegm.
